Transaction 58c0f51e620c3a592050cc073d665f070ffe480ea9652f04f4da2c7993253ba1
1 Input
1 Output
-
58c0f51e620c3a592050cc073d665f070ffe480ea9652f04f4da2c7993253ba1:0
- value
- 41237
- script pubkey
- OP_0 OP_PUSHBYTES_32 2d2f0589b160e36b0310e9841aa524f6072dc9eea1e1a3f6eb36a1e00bcc40c9
- address
- bc1q95hstzd3vr3kkqcsaxzp4ffy7crjmj0w58s68ahtx6s7qz7vgrys5pzd0e